Happy National Salad Month! That's right – the entire month of May is dedicated to celebrating the delicious and healthy dish that is salads. This annual holiday was first started in 1992 by the Association for Dressings and Sauces, as a way to promote the consumption of fruits and vegetables in a tasty way. Salads have been around since ancient times, with evidence of Roman emperors enjoying them as early as 30 BC. But now, there are endless possibilities when it comes to creating a perfect salad, from traditional Caesar salads to modern fruit-based options. So let's raise our forks and celebrate this versatile and refreshing meal all month long!
